Output e045500b32596b71ab0b636fc71cda3ffbc294f232b6d7d24204aef5af520167:0

value
21107035
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f45f2b35c716f95c2198b4f3e6b5b7f8c904e337 OP_EQUAL
address
3Py8onzYEaoCFbHetKgMq1E8st4zgm52Jj
transaction
e045500b32596b71ab0b636fc71cda3ffbc294f232b6d7d24204aef5af520167
confirmations
170238
spent
true